Spend a lazy afternoon – Located in the heart of Munich, Englischer Garten or English Garden is one of the largest city parks in Europe. The park gets its name from the landscape layout which was influenced by the English style gardens famous during the 18th century. The area of over 900 acres is the green lung of Munich. The park is a popular recreational joint for locals. You can spot them chatting, singing, sunbathing, jogging, biking, or even surfing over a manmade wave. The odd attractions inside the park include Chinesischer Turm (Chinese pagoda), Japanese Teahouse, and Monopteros (Greek temple) located on a small hilltop. The highlights here are the two beer gardens. The beer gardens located near Kleinhesseloher Lake and Chinesischer Turm are the most popular hangout places for locals, and as well as tourists. Even with a capacity of more than 7,000 seats, the beer gardens get pretty crowded during summer season. Get your hands on the local brew, and find a bench to enjoy the festive atmosphere around these beer gardens. This is the best way to unwind after few days of sightseeing.
